Shaw Trust is recruiting for an IPS Employment Specialist to work in the community, focusing on helping clients with mental health support needs secure sustainable paid employment using the IPS approach.

The role involves managing a caseload, delivering person-centred guidance, and building relationships with local employers to place clients in suitable roles.

This is a target-driven position aligned with Starts On Programme, Job Entries, Job Retention and Fidelity delivery models.
